Bolton: Trump only sees his own interests instead of America’s interests

PNN – John Bolton, the national security adviser of former US President Donald Trump’s administration, said while Trump is preparing for the 2024 presidential election campaign, he does not think about national interests and only focuses on his own interests.

According to the report of Pakistan News Network, Bolton expressed his opinion in a conversation with Al-Arabiya channel: My conclusion after 17 months of serving in the Trump administration was that he is not suitable for the presidency. Part of the reason is that he doesn’t understand how the US federal government works.

He emphasized: He didn’t know much when Trump came and he didn’t know much when he left either.

Bolton believes: He does not think about national interests and only focuses on his own interests. He does not have a political philosophy and does not think in a political framework.

The National Security Adviser of the former US government explained about the personality of his former president: It is very difficult to predict what Trump will do after a possible victory. You can look at a lot of what he did in the first round and expect that to continue.

The 2024 US presidential election will be held in November of this year in a situation where the 4-year presidency of “Joe Biden” has faced many events in the field of foreign policy, including the war in Ukraine and the war in Gaza. In domestic politics, issues such as preserving democracy, fighting inflation, and the issue of immigration are considered the most challenging issues.

The most likely competitor for Joe Biden is currently Donald Trump. Although the intra-party stage of the election has not yet been completed, Trump’s performance in the two states where voting was conducted, as well as polls, indicate that he does not have much of a problem being nominated by the Republican Party.

The results of the polls show that Biden and Trump will have a close fight in a possible competition in November. In the latest poll conducted by NPR/PBS, 48% of voters preferred Biden and 47% preferred Trump.
